o-Nitro-benzhydrylbromid, also known as 2-nitrobenzhydryl bromide, is a chemical compound with the molecular formula C13H10BrNO2. It is a derivative of benzhydryl bromide, featuring a nitro group (-NO2) at the ortho position (2nd position) of the benzene ring. This yellow crystalline solid is primarily used as a reagent in organic synthesis, particularly in the preparation of various pharmaceuticals and other chemical compounds. Due to its reactivity, o-nitro-benzhydrylbromid is sensitive to light and moisture, and it is typically stored under controlled conditions to maintain its stability.
